What is the difference betweenbeingin love andfallingin love?

Courtesy Berkley Publishing

If you think about it, theres a big difference between being in love and falling in love.

As DeAlto mentioned, falling in love is the first phase of a romantic relationship.

This can often be characterized by a rush of excitement and tons of attraction.

alt

Its also the time, as DeAlto noted when peoples flaws can seem invisible to their new partners.

On the other hand, being in love is much deeper.

In this stage, couples will have a sense of comfort, security, and mutual respect.

This phase involves building a life together, facing challenges, and developing a deeper understanding of each other.

The relationship becomes grounded in companionship and long-term commitment.

Do feelings of love change over time?

Plain and simple, feelings of love can change.

However, this is not a bad thing.

Thats because love can grow, evolve, and strengthen over time.

In strong, healthy partnerships, love is always evolving, says Groskopf.

Each person must nurture their relationship to keep the love alive.

By having honest communication, their love can really grow.
